WASHINGTON COUNTY, Pa. —

Emergency crews responded to the scene of a car accident at a Coal Center post office Tuesday morning.

According to Washington County 911 dispatchers, a car crashed into the post office on Spring Street just before 11 a.m. Tuesday.

Authorities at the scene told Channel 11 News there are minor injuries in the crash.

No other details about the crash have been released. The incident remains under investigation.
